Common Shona Phrases in Mongolian

Phrase Meaning
Mhoro! Сайн уу!
Mangwanani akanaka! Өглөөний мэнд!
Masikati akanaka! Өдрийн мэнд!
Manheru akanaka! Оройн мэнд!
Mhoro shamwari yangu! Сайн уу найз минь!
Makadii? Юу байна?
Ndiri zvakanaka, ndatenda! Би сайн, баярлалаа!
ndakakusuwa би чамайг санасан
Ndokutenda zvikuru)! Маш их баярлалаа)!
Unogamuchirwa! Та тавтай морил!
Pinda mukati! Ороорой!
Iva nezuva rakanaka! Өдрийг сайхан өнгөрүүлээрэй!
Phrase Meaning
Sara mushe! Баяртай!
Bhavhadhe rinofadza! Төрсөн өдрийн мэнд!
Zita rako ndiani? Таны нэр хэн бэ?
Unogara kupi? Чи хаана амьдардаг вэ?
Ndipewo nhamba yako yefoni? Би таны утасны дугаарыг авч болох уу?
Ndinokuda Би чамд хайртай
Iwe wakanyanya kukosha! Та маш онцгой юм!
handisi kunzwisisa! Би ойлгохгүй байна!
Unga ndibatsira here? Та надад тусалж чадах уу?
Fonera amburenzi! Түргэн тусламж дууд!
Dana chiremba! Эмч дууд!
Daidza mapurisa! Цагдаа дууд!
Tsika nevanhu vainakidza chaizvo Соёл, хүмүүс их сонирхолтой байсан

About Shona Language

According to Wikipedia.org, Shona is a Bantu language and is spoken by the Shona people of Zimbabwe. The language was codified by the colonial government and became popular during the 1950s. According to Ethnologue, the language was spoken in the Zezuru, Korekore, and Karanga dialects. It is spoken by 7.5 million people. Shona has Manyika and Ndau dialects and is spoken by 1,025,000 and 2,380,000 people. It is called Shona and is similar to the Ndau (Eastern Shona) and Karanga (Western Shona). Shona is a written standard language and became popular in the early 20th century. In the 1920s, the Rhodesian administration offered schoolbooks and other materials in Shona. The first novel in Shona was published in 1957. It is taught in the schools and has literature in the monolingual and bilingual dictionaries. The Standard Shona has a specific dialect and is spoken by the Karanga people of Masvingo Province. Shona dialects are taught in local schools.

About Mongolian Language

According to Wikipedia.org, Mongolian is the official language of Mongolia. It is most widely spoken and best-known for being a part of the Mongolic language family. Mongolian is spoken by 5.2 million people worldwide. The language is spoken by a vast majority of the residents of Mongolia. In Mongolia, the Khalkha dialect is common. It is currently written in both Cyrillic and traditional Mongolian scripts. The language is dialectally more diverse and is displayed in the traditional Mongolian script. The variety of Mongolian is written in Standard Khalkha Mongolian. The written language is formalized in the writing conventions. It is similar to other Mongolic languages like Buryat and Oirat.
